<p>There are moments in teaching when we, as teachers, have the blessing of experiencing a “Holy Spirit” moment with our children. Recently, my kindergarten class had such an encounter. As the movement of the Holy Spirit flowed through these five- and six-year-old children, a song filled with praise to God was created. </p>
<p>This story began while I was teaching the children a simple praise and worship song one afternoon, when one child piped up in her clear little voice and said, “Mrs. McCallum, why don’t we make up our OWN song to God?” I was momentarily taken aback, but the other children were not. They began to voice approval of the idea, clearly excited about the possibility. The words which were so quickly forming on my tongue, however, threatened to squelch what the Holy Spirit was about to do. As I opened my mouth to “redirect” the class, I felt the Lord prodding me to agree to this request. </p>
<p>The children raised their hands, and one by one, they began giving me phrases that expressed their love for the Lord. I wrote them on the board as fast as I could—thoughts and words came quickly and creatively from these precious kids. When a natural end came to this process, another little one raised her hand and asked, “So can we sing the song now?” This question made me smile, as I was already wondering how on earth I would be able to compile all of these precious phrases into a song that seemed to flow and make sense. In that moment, I realized that I would not be able to do it, but God would. </p>
<p>The day that I sat down to put the song together, I was amazed at how easily the phrases formed full thoughts, how the thoughts formed verses, and how the verses formed a song. Yet again, I underestimated what GOD could do. I put the song to a tune, and this sweet kindergarten class now has a song which truly shows the heart of worship — the hearts of 16 wonderful kindergarten children. </p>
<p>The kids love singing the song. They have made up motions to it, and each time they sing it, you can see the pride in their smiles. When they close their eyes to sing the words in the song, “We praise you; we love you Lord,” I can see the love in their hearts. I have thanked God on several occasions that He saved me from my own agenda that day so that He could bless my class and me with His agenda. </p>

<p><a href="http://libertylife.libertychristian.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/02/Impact_3.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-123" title="Impact_3" src="http://libertylife.libertychristian.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/02/Impact_3.jpg" alt="" width="267" height="200" /></a>Choruses like “Let Your name be lifted higher … be lifted higher … be lifted higher … ” were heard recently at Liberty as more than 150 seventh and eighth grade students, their Upper School Impact leaders, and Middle School Youth Pastor Matt Bowles gathered for a time of praise, worship, and prayer after Friday night’s basketball game last month. Hearts were touched, encouraging words were spoken, and God was glorified.</p>
<p>“As a parent, it was truly awesome to see these young hearts so devoted to doing what God wants them to do,” said teacher and parent Kristy Howell. “They were encouraging and praying, with arms wrapped around each other.”</p>
<p>Liberty Impact is a student-led mentoring and ministry program designed for Middle School students. A select group of juniors and seniors who have hearts that want to serve God and others meet weekly with the small group of Middle School students they have been given to encourage and pray with them.</p>
<p>Juniors are assigned to a group of seventh graders, and the juniors serve as mentors to their group of seventh graders for two years, as the leaders become seniors and their Middle School group becomes eighth graders. These juniors and seniors enjoy hanging out and loving on their Middle School students.</p>
<p>Howell went on to say about Impact night, “God’s Spirit was present, like a snippet of heaven.</p>
<p>“The ‘Spirit of Liberty’ and ministries like IMPACT are a beacon of hope in this fallen world.”</p>
